Recent Donations

So far in this Rotary Year (from July 1st), the Rotary Club of Lantzville has donated more than $21,500 to various individuals and organizations in your local community and our international community, including:

$200 to Mei-San (below) to help her attend the Forum for Young Canadians in Ottawa where she will learn how parliament works.  She has promised to return to the Club, after her weekend, and explain 'how parliament works'.

$200 to the Nanaimo Telephone Visiting Society

Ralph$500 to  Nanaimo's First Baptist Church's  Mexico Mission (above) to cover some of the costs they incur while helping disadvantaged people in Mexico build simple houses.

$5400 (including over $1300 donated by members) to Shelter Box Canada - towards their work helping those affected by natural disasters such as the recent earthquake in Haiti.

$250 towards the construction of a school in Afghanistan.  This is a multi-Club project, recognizing the 100th anniversary of the chartering of the first Rotary Club in Canada (in Winnipeg in 1910)

$737 (raised at a silent auction and not-so-silent auction at our Christmas dinner) to the Georgia Avenue Community School - towards the school's lunch program

$1000 (plus another $1000 from a grant from the Rotary Foundation) to the Georgia Avenue Community School - towards the school's Literacy Improvement program

$600 to Bookfest, the Children's Literature Round Table

$750 to the VISO - towards their Children's Program

$750 each to the Salvation Army, Nanaimo's 7-10 Club, Haven House and the Loaves & Fishes Foodbank - towards their Christmas programs.

$300 to Sue A. to offset some of the costs of visiting a very sick husband in Victoria

$500 to the Boys & Girls Club - towards their purchase of a changing table and a car seat

$500 to Operation Red Nose - to pay for the gas used by volunteer drivers

$500 towards a multi-Club commitment towards new latrines for a school in Bukati, Kenya

$1000 to Sara D  - to help her buy an insulin pump that will help prepare her for recruitment by and service with the RCMP

$750 to the Georgia Avenue Secondary School - towards their in-school breakfast program

$3333 to the Nanaimo Museum - the final installment of a $10,000 commitment to the Musuem's Public Use Room

$500 to the Nanaimo-Ladysmith Schools' Foundation - towards their Students' Support Fund

$820 to Loaves & Fishes - towards renovations to the Food Bank.

$525 to the Vancouver Island Children's Art Festival

$2,500 to the VIU Foundation - the final installment towards the Rotary Club of Lantzville Award ($500 annualy to a successful first year student at VIU)
